Sans Superellipse Edked 2 is a regular weight, normal width, low contrast, italic, normal x-height font.

A streamlined oblique sans built from rounded-rectangle geometry, with corners softened into superellipse-like curves. Strokes stay largely uniform, producing a crisp, engineered texture with minimal modulation. Counters tend toward squared bowls and open apertures, while terminals are clean and consistently rounded rather than tapered or flared. Proportions feel slightly condensed and forward-leaning, giving lines a fast rhythm; the lowercase maintains a clear, workmanlike construction with single-storey forms and compact joins that keep word shapes tight.

This style suits interface labels, app or device typography, and technical branding where a compact, forward-moving voice is helpful. It also works well for sports, automotive, and esports-style graphics, headings, and short promotional copy where the distinctive rounded-square silhouette can carry personality without heavy decoration.

The overall tone reads modern and performance-oriented, with a subtle sci‑fi/tech influence. Its forward slant and rounded-square forms suggest speed, precision, and contemporary product design rather than warmth or nostalgia.

The design appears intended to merge geometric clarity with a softened, contemporary edge, using rounded-rectangle construction to stay legible while feeling fast and engineered. The built-in oblique stance reinforces a sense of motion and modernity for display and brand-forward applications.

The italics are integral to the design rather than a simple slant, with many curves and joins shaped to preserve the rounded-rectangular motif. Numerals mirror the same squarish curves and consistent stroke weight, helping mixed alphanumerics look cohesive in UI-like contexts.
